Decoding the High-Efficiency Ringmotor & Direct-Drive Paradigm

In modern heavy industrial manufacturing, traditional high-speed, gear-reduced motor packages are increasingly being replaced by direct-drive Ringmotors and Permanent Magnet Synchronous Motors (PMSMs). The primary technical driver behind this transition is the elimination of mechanical power transmission losses, significantly reducing footprint, noise, and vibration while boosting thermodynamic efficiency.

A Ringmotor represents the peak of electrical machine architecture, utilising a large-diameter stator and rotor layout to achieve high pole counts. This structural design enables the delivery of massive torque at exceptionally low speeds, making them the gold standard for high-duty cycle applications. By integrating these systems directly with mechanical loads—such as grinding mills, large-scale ventilation shafts, ship propellers, and chemical mixing turbines—engineers can realize thermodynamic efficiency profiles that outperform traditional mechanical drive trains.

The Crucial Role of CE Certification in Global Procurement

For global procurement managers, safety compliance is a non-negotiable metric. CE (Conformité Européenne) Certification acts as the regulatory passport for access to the European Economic Area (EEA). Our products undergo rigorous testing to comply with the European Eco-design Directives, including EU Regulation 2019/1781.

Our compliance covers two main pillars:

  • Low Voltage Directive (LVD) 2014/35/EU: Ensures the insulation systems, dielectric strength, and ground fault safety protocols protect personnel and peripheral systems from hazardous electrical discharge.
  • Electromagnetic Compatibility (EMC) Directive 2014/30/EU: Confirms the motor does not emit excessive electromagnetic interference (EMI) that could disrupt precision digital process instrumentation, and possesses sufficient immunity to local grid power fluctuations.

Furthermore, CE certified motors align seamlessly with IE3 and IE4 efficiency standards. Q1: What technical characteristics differentiate a Ringmotor from a standard high-speed induction motor?
A Ringmotor relies on an expanded structural diameter and high pole-count layout. This allows the rotor to apply high tangential force directly to the load at low rotational speeds, achieving direct-drive functionality. Standard induction motors feature high RPM profiles requiring complex reductions via gearboxes, adding components that are susceptible to friction loss and mechanical wear.
Q2: How does CE Certification affect international project compliance for industrial powertrains?
CE Certification shows that the motor conforms to European health, safety, and environmental protection directives. Crucially, this validates compliance with Low Voltage (LVD) and Electromagnetic Compatibility (EMC) regulations. It ensures safety during grid fluctuations and guarantees that electromagnetic noise will not cause interference with digital instruments or automation controls on site.

Q6: How is insulation reliability guaranteed on high-voltage and VFD-driven systems?
We utilize Class F or Class H insulation systems incorporating advanced vacuum-pressure impregnation (VPI) with high-grade resins. For VFD-driven installations (like our YVF converter-fed series), we offer optional insulated non-drive end bearings or grounding brushes to mitigate micro-sparking erosion caused by shaft currents.
